Celebrate Gospel Music Heritage Month in September
The September programming lineup for Gospel Music Channel’s third annual Gospel Music Heritage Month has been announced.
Gospel Music Heritage Month, a celebration of Gospel music’s valuable, long-standing contributions to American culture, was first designated by Congress in 2008 as a result of a push spearheaded by GMC, the Gospel Music Association and The Recording Academy®.

Gospel Music Channel and Ebony/Jet Partner Up
Gospel Music History Gets A Boost From Gospel Music Channel and Ebony/Jet

Gospel Music Channel and the Ebony/Jet Entertainment Group are teaming up to develop television, magazine and online initiatives to promote gospel music history. Gospel Music Channel has revealed that it has worked with Ebony/Jet to create several 90-minute specials on the history of gospel music.
The series, This Week in Gospel Music History, began running earlier this month as part of GMC’s Nation Gospel Music Heritage Month. Video and photo galleries will be available on the websites of Gospel Music Channel and Ebony/Jet and there will also be a “Gospel Music Experience” sweepstakes that is going to give away a trip for two to the 2010 Stellar Awards.
